In an intriguing online session, individuals sought insights and guidance through clairsentience practice. As participants asked questions about personal growth and challenges, a mix of positive support and curious inquiries emerged, highlighting a growing interest in shadow work and self-discovery.

Rising Interest in Shadow Work

Participants like Jasmine expressed a desire for clarity on shadow work, asking, "where or how should I start?" This resonated with many others who share similar journeys. Users reported feelings of connection to their inner child alongside messages urging them to unpack and integrate past experiences.

Key Insights and Guidance

Comments revealed a shared sentiment among participants:

  • Personal Connection: A participant recalled visualizing a childhood self, suggesting, "Can you try and connect with her and see what she is writing?" This notion of connecting with a younger self sparked interest among others seeking help.

  • Clarity Through Crystals: Recommendations to use black tourmaline and other crystals emerged as a form of guidance, enhancing the therapeutic aspect of shadow work. One user highlighted, "Meditate with black tourmalineask your higher selfwhat shadows need light."

  • Symbolic Messages: Another participant saw a "house of cards," which provoked discussions about unstable foundations and the necessity for individuals to reevaluate their lives.

"For you, your shadow work feels like taking a flashlight into a dark basement"

The conversation veered towards personal connections and future endeavors, featuring queries about family acceptance, educational pursuits, and workplace dynamics.
